QAnon supporters gather for return of dead JFK Jr – he obviously doesn’t show up

QAnon supporters gather in Dallas

A QAnon prophecy predicts he will return and make Trump president again…

Hundreds of QAnon supporters travelled to Texas on Tuesday (November 2) as they believed JFK Jr would be revealing he is not in fact dead and instead announcing a 2024 presidential run with none other than former president Donald Trump.

Members of the group converged outside the AT&T Discovery Plaza in downtown Dallas, the site of John F. Kennedy’s assassination in 1963, in the belief that the former president’s son – who died in a plane crash in 1999 – would be rising from the grave.

A theory has developed in the group that JFK Jr’s plane accident was actually just a ruse to fake his death.

QAnon is a conspiracy theory group based on unfounded and outlandish claims and suggestions that Trump is waging a secret war against elite Satan-worshipping paedophiles in government, business and the media.

Many of the group’s members and supporters were involved in the January 6 attack on the US capitol building.

Whilst the former president has never endorsed the group, he has also never called them out – describing its supporters as “people who love our country.”

According to VICE, JFK Jr. has been part of QAnon lore for some time, with theories starting in June 2018 when someone claiming to be him posted on the message board 8chan. He suggested he was the person behind the QAnon movement.

One Twitter account, Whiplash347, said that Trump would be reinstated as the 18th president of the United States, because everything after 1871 – when the US supposedly became a corporation – is “illegal”.

He will then step down and allow JFK Jr. to become president, with disgraced former National Security Adviser Michael Flynn as his vice president.

Unsurprisingly, none of this happened on Tuesday.
